Joachim Gauck speaks to students Brunswick
Wednesday 15 September, 16 clock: The Braunschweig Volkswagen Halle is up to the last seat sold out. Hundreds of students and teachers of the Brunswick schools are eagerly waiting for their main character of this afternoon:
Joachim Gauck - committed system opponents during the peaceful revolution in East Germany, the first Federal Commissioner for Stasi documents; outstanding protagonist in the process of reunification, the most recent candidate for the Office of the President. In short, a key figure in the recent German history. First, the traditional
prefaces: the sponsors, Mayor Gert Hoffmann. They act on the young people boring and inconsequential. After 30 minutes, lit a huge cheering the hall. Gauck takes the stage.
Contrary to the expectations of most of the afternoon would amount to a lengthy history department, amused and aroused Mr. Gauck the audience to talk to his charismatic persona. By means of the fictitious young characters Marie and Paul tries to get his as well as the general history of the former GDR too close, especially the students. What he succeeds! The then-party dictatorship under the SED, that the entire population in all its Of life seems suppressed in those few minutes than to be alive and present in the history lessons before. Big eyes, spellbound eyes and grinning, or even slightly open mouths reflect the quiet enthusiasm of the audience. What
took with us?
Gauck says, happiness is not material, but rather defined by the chance to take responsibility - be it to participate in political elections, it is generally to identify shortcomings in our current system and to combat them.
True words, which are even days after the 15th September for thought (to be).
